MEMO — Department Heads

Re: Harrowgate Lease

Talks with Bexleton Holdings on the Harrowgate site resume Thursday. We're pushing for a five-year term with a break clause at year three; they want seven, no break. Facilities has costed both. Do not commit headcount moves until terms are signed. Keep this off floor-level channels. The confidential note below outlines where this fits in our broader plans.

board note of kagep-yahig: Only 9 of the 120 pilot accounts renewed Quenix, so a churn review is set for April 1.

**Action Item 4:** The Brindlekit component library allowed floating minor-version ranges, which let an unreviewed release reach production. We now pin exact versions and gate upgrades behind signature checks in the Copperline registry. Security review should confirm the pinning policy and the verification timeouts, which are set by the constants below.

tuning table, kajog-kawef:
PRIORITIES = {
    "kelox": 870,
    "kasix": 89,
    "eliax": 988,
}

Changelog — Gridfable 3.2: the setting formerly named `FORMULA_EVAL_MODE` is now `FORMULA_SANDBOX_LEVEL`, reflecting that user-supplied formulas always run sandboxed; the knob only controls strictness. The old name still works but logs a deprecation warning and will be removed in 3.4. Update any deploy scripts at the sync this week. Note the sandbox broker also now requires authentication, so every environment's env file needs the broker credential added. The line to append is:

vault entry, hawip-bahif: COURIER_KEY20=0cc4378a8ab04bccc3fd

### Checklist: Deploy-Status Chat Bot — Plugin Compatibility

If your plugin posts through the Ombrelle deploy bot, verify it handles the new status payload shape: the phase field is now an enum, and free-text statuses are rejected. Test against the sandbox channel before release day. Confirm your plugin reports the correct build by matching the token shown below.

trace token, tawep-fahif: htk3_b58